Hello Eric,
We regret for the inconvenience caused. Please check whether you have installed any other conflicting applications like McAfee, Avast, Norton etc… on your PC, If so please uninstall the conflicting applications.
If not, please  click this link http://aa-download.avg.com/filedir/util/AVG_Remover.exe to download and run the AVG Remover tool to remove all the traces of the AVG.
1. Please select the AVG products which are shown in the remover tool window and then start removal process.
2. After the remover tool process is successfully finished, restart your computer.
3. After the restart,  manually delete the AVG Remover folder in the C drive of My computer.

Eric, General info… What Windows OS are you using?.. Before Win 8 Windows Defender was only an anti-spyware product. Since Win 8 was introduced it's been re-classified as an anti-virus product (https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Windows_Defender) so it's possible that it can conflict with AVG so that's why it's turned off/disabled.
